Output 69043c8f5222a5c64c9e7949639e7cf57ceeed9b7301b265f8c130221812952f:1

value
2599544
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 421de6e664b44b1f5effc9161bc2e8ecdaa66590 OP_EQUALVERIFY OP_CHECKSIG
address
172bRHXVgD8hshtXXwERayNNZ3hVd5dwk6
transaction
69043c8f5222a5c64c9e7949639e7cf57ceeed9b7301b265f8c130221812952f
spent
true